{"product_id":"greek-three-hole-ceramic-vase-by-nikos-dazelidi-1960s","title":"Greek Three Hole Ceramic Vase by Nikos Dazelidi, 1960s","description":"\u003cp\u003eA ceramic vase by Greek artist Nikos Dazelidi, created in Athens in the 1960s, and signed by the artist. The form is approached as both vessel and object, balancing utility with a distinct presence.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e body is low and rounded, its silhouette soft yet intentional, shaped with a sense of contained volume rather than vertical reach. From its surface rise three short cylindrical openings, unevenly spaced, introducing a rhythm that feels organic rather than measured. \u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e gesture suggests function, but also abstraction, an arrangement that invites interpretation as much as use.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eIts glaze carries a muted, mint-toned palette, softened by a gentle, almost chalky finish. Subtle variations in tone move across the surface, with warm speckling emerging beneath the glaze, giving the piece a quiet depth. The coloration feels atmospheric rather than applied, as though it has settled into the form over time.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eOn one side, a circular aperture interrupts the mass, revealing a spiraling interior detail. This recessed element introduces contrast in both color and structure, drawing the eye inward.
